HIPAA eLearning

Designed for a public university, this interactive eLearning experience teaches about the permitted use and disclosure of protected health information for students, staff, and employees.

Audience: Employees who are entrusted with information that is protected by the Health Insurance Portability Accountability Act (HIPAA).
Learning Objectives: The learner will describe the basic privacy protections for health information provided by HIPAA and identify the duties imposed on persons with access to protected health information (PHI) in order to fulfill those privacy requirements.
Tool Used: Articulate Rise 360

PowerPoint Screencast

This screencast is a micro lesson designed to teach viewers how to create a custom color palette for their presentations on PowerPoint.

Audience: Students and Professionals who use PowerPoint to create presentations or projects.
Learning Objective: The learner will create a color palette on PowerPoint by adding colors from an image using the dropper tool or color hex codes.
Tools Used: PowerPoint, Screenpal

Interactive Tutorial

This interactive tutorial walks the user through setting up a custom banner on their Google Classroom site. Incorporating iorad’s innovative technology, the user interacts by clicking or dragging specific buttons as they learn each step.

Audience: Teachers and Professionals who use Google Classroom.
Learning Objective: The learner will be able to customize the class banner on their Google Classroom site.
Tools Used: Google Classroom, iorad
